Vinzenz: Problem mit Addition

Beitrag lesen

Hallo ThomasNT4

$total = 0;
  while (!feof($handle)) {
   $buffer = fgets($handle, 4096);
echo $buffer;
$total = 0;

Warum setzt Du bei jedem Schleifendurchlauf $total auf 0 zurück?
Ist das Absicht?
Sauber strukturierter Code ist leichter lesbar und weniger fehlerträchtig.

$total1 = $total += $buffer;

Zur Sicherstellung der Reihenfolge der Zuweisungen empfiehlt sich das Setzen von Klammern. Es macht den Code lesbarer auch wenn die Klammern nicht notwendig sind.

}
echo $total1;

Freundliche Grüsse,

Vinzenz